Food•Some animals are carnivores.
•Some animals are herbivores.
•Some animals are omnivores.
Carnivores• Carnivores are
animals who eat only meat. These flesh eating animals some times do not need to eat for 2 or three days after a meal. Examples of carnivores include Lions and Tigers, these animals are known as predators. That means they hunt other animals and kill them for food.
Herbivores• Herbivores are animals
who are vegetarians, they eat only plants. Vegetarians often have to eat vast amounts of plants to get enough nutrition, because plants are easily digestible. Examples of vegetarian animals are elephants, giraffes, cows, rabbits, and sheep. These animals spend most of their days grazing and eating.
Omnivores
• Omnivores are animals who have a mixed diet, and eat both meat and plants. An obvious example is a human being-us!
